Arsenal's Eddie Nketiah makes Dani Ceballos admission after West Ham winner
Eddie Nketiah admits he was thrilled to have bagged the winner in Arsenal's first home game of the new Premier League season. The Gunners welcomed West Ham to the Emirates on Saturday night and were looking to maintain their 100 per cent start to the new season.
